Step-by-Step Replacement Guide
Changing a vinyl window handle is a manageable DIY job that can typically be finished within an hour. Here's how to do it:
Step 1: Identify the Type of Handle
Before acquiring a replacement, figure out the type of window handle you have. Examine the maker's guidelines or speak with a professional if needed.
Action 2: Gather Your Tools
When you have actually recognized the handle type, collect the tools and materials noted above.
Step 3: Remove the Old Handle
- Loosen the Handle: Locate the screws that hold the handle in location. Utilize the suitable screwdriver to unscrew them carefully.
- Pull the Handle Off: Once the screws are removed, carefully pull the handle far from the window. If it sticks, utilize an energy knife to carefully pry it away without damaging the window frame.
Step 4: Prepare for Installation
- Clean the Area: Ensure the location around the handle is tidy and without dust and particles. This can help the brand-new handle in shape snugly.
- Oil: If needed, apply a percentage of lube to the handle system for smoother operation.
Step 5: Install the New Handle
- Position the New Handle: Align the new handle with the screw holes on the window frame.
- Protect the Handle: Insert the screws and tighten them with the screwdriver. Ensure they are tight but avoid over-tightening, as this can remove the screws or harm the frame.
Action 6: Test the Handle
Once the new handle is set up, test it to ensure it opens and closes efficiently. If it feels stiff or does not run correctly, recheck the installation and make any essential changes.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How do I understand if I need to change my window handle?
Indications that you might require to change your window handle consist of trouble opening or closing the window, a loose handle, or visible damage to the handle itself.
2. Can I utilize a universal window handle for my vinyl window?
While some universal window manages might fit multiple window types, it is normally advisable to utilize a replacement handle that matches the specific type and brand of your window for optimal performance and security.
3. How much does it cost to change a window handle?
The expense of replacing a window handle can differ extensively based upon the type of handle and brand name. On average, you can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 15 and ₤ 50 for a replacement handle, with additional expenses for professional setup if needed.
4. Is it suggested to tackle this replacement as a DIY task?
Yes, replacing a window handle is a relatively basic DIY job that numerous homeowners can handle themselves, supplied they have the right tools and follow the guidelines thoroughly.
